pub fn merklize(prefix: &str, data: &[MerkleNode], depth: u16) -> MerkleNode {
let len = data.len();
let mut engine = MerkleNode::engine();
let tag = format!("{}:merkle:{}", prefix, depth);
let tag_hash = sha256::Hash::hash(tag.as_bytes());
engine.input(&tag_hash[..]);
engine.input(&tag_hash[..]);
match len {
0 => {
0u8.commit_encode(&mut engine);
0u8.commit_encode(&mut engine);
}
1 => {
data.first()
.expect("We know that we have one element")
.commit_encode(&mut engine);
0u8.commit_encode(&mut engine);
}
2 => {
data.first()
.expect("We know that we have at least two elements")
.commit_encode(&mut engine);
data.last()
.expect("We know that we have at least two elements")
.commit_encode(&mut engine);
}
_ => {
let div = len / 2;
merklize(prefix, &data[0..div], depth + 1)
.commit_encode(&mut engine);
merklize(prefix, &data[div..], depth + 1)
.commit_encode(&mut engine);
}
}
MerkleNode::from_engine(engine)
}
